CHRISTIAN MILLER, A. 13.. Brodhead, Wis. Editor-in-Chief of Record Christian by name and by nature, this Haxen-haired descendant of Leif the Lucky? admits that the plains of Wiscon- sin are preferable to the mountains of Norway. His years at Valparaiso have been busy and fruitful. In spite of his 13.- bors as Managing Editor of the Torch and Editor-in-Chief of the Record, Miller, in the meantime, has taken a step farther than most of us have dared goehe has ugot married. JUANITA FRAGEMAN, A. 8., Pleasant Hill, Mo. Alpha Phi Delta Secretary Senior Class Juanita is a girl full of life, hope, and aspirations.f She has the ability to fix her eyes upon a goal and to work until she reacheseit. She never forgets to take time to be cheerful along the way. She has a winning personality which has secured for her a host of friends. HERMAN L. NEWSOM, A. B., LeRoy, W. Va. Class Orator Phi Delta Psi Fraternity Managing Editor, Record Herman is clever, insinuating, always showing the belle esprit, and active in societies, where his wit and harmless po- litical meneuvers, which outface detection, make him a leader. His untiring efforts in behalf of the Dixie Society have won for the society unparallelled footing, and for himself profound respect. Phi Delta Psi Benson has been a diligent worker among us ever since he came to Valpo in the fall of l9l3. He was track manager of the High School Department in l9l3- '14 and l9l4-,l5, and won the Brown Cup both years. For several years he was wrestling instructor for the llY . He has the degree Ph. C. from our Pharmacy De- partment and has made an enviable rec- ord for himself as a student chemist. MYRTLE JOHNSON, A. B., Joliet, Ill.
